Output 62ebd4a18389366fdc3572ec0a738a036b043919034d09db68df9684d2f849f9:0

value
120600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d598e68618197043c02a26d02afe68ae2324698 OP_EQUAL
address
3EaQV563LByFaH1CnxhGrVrRakRrYsJ6pq
transaction
62ebd4a18389366fdc3572ec0a738a036b043919034d09db68df9684d2f849f9
spent
true